    What Is Unitary Method?

    To clearly understand what is unitary method, it is important to look at the meaning of the word “unitary.” The term comes from the word unit, which means one. The unitary method is a mathematical technique in which the value of one unit is found first, and then this value is used to calculate the value of multiple units.

    In simple words, the unitary method answers two basic questions:

    • What is the value of one item?

    • What is the value of many such items?

    For example, if 8 chocolates cost ₹40, the unitary method helps find the cost of one chocolate first and then the cost of any number of chocolates. This logical breakdown helps students avoid confusion and improve accuracy.

    The unitary method in maths is considered a foundation concept because it strengthens reasoning skills and prepares students for advanced topics such as ratios, proportions, percentages, and algebraic thinking.

    Unitary Method Formula Explained for Students

    Understanding the unitary method formula is essential for solving problems correctly and efficiently. Although the method does not rely on a single fixed formula, it follows a consistent pattern that can be applied to different situations.

    Basic Unitary Method Formula:

    If the value of x units = y,
    Then the value of 1 unit = y ÷ x,
    And the value of n units = (y ÷ x) × n

    This simple structure forms the backbone of all unitary method sums. Whether the problem involves cost, time, distance, or work, the same logic applies. Students learn to identify the given quantity, calculate the value of one unit, and then multiply it to find the required answer.

    Here, the unitary method formula encourages clarity in thinking and reduces the likelihood of calculation errors, especially in word-based problems.

    Step-by-Step Approach to Solving Unitary Method Sums

    Following a structured approach makes unitary method sums easier and more manageable, even for beginners.

    Step 1: Read and Understand the Problem

    Read the question carefully to identify the given values and what needs to be calculated. Understanding relationships between quantities helps avoid mistakes and ensures the correct method is applied.

    Step 2: Find the Value of One Unit

    Divide the total value by the number of units given to find the value of a single unit. This step forms the foundation of the unitary method calculation.

    Step 3: Find the Required Quantity

    Multiply the value of one unit by the number of units required in the question. This helps calculate the final answer accurately using proportional reasoning.

    Step 4: Verify the Answer

    Recheck all calculations and ensure the final answer logically matches the problem situation. Verification helps catch errors and improves confidence in mathematical problem-solving.

    This systematic process helps students stay organised and avoid common errors.

    Unitary Method Examples for Clear Understanding

    Practising unitary method examples is the most effective way to master this concept. Examples help students understand how the same method can be applied to different types of problems.

    Example 1: Cost-Based Problem

    If 12 pens cost ₹180, find the cost of 5 pens.
    Cost of 1 pen = 180 ÷ 12 = ₹15
    Cost of 5 pens = 15 × 5 = ₹75

    Example 2: Time-Based Problem

    If 6 workers can complete a job in 15 days, how long will 1 worker take?
    Time taken by 1 worker = 15 × 6 = 90 days

    These unitary method examples show how finding one unit first simplifies the entire problem.

    Common Mistakes Students Make in Unitary Method

    Despite its simplicity, students often make mistakes while solving unitary method problems. Recognising these errors can help improve accuracy.

    Common mistakes include:

    • Forgetting to calculate the value of one unit

    • Using multiplication instead of division or vice versa

    • Misreading the number of units

    • Skipping steps while solving

    • Not checking the final answer

    By practising carefully and following each step, students can avoid these errors and improve their performance.
